Navigating Discomfort and Discomfort



To alleviate any pain or pain after your oral implant procedure, think about taking over-the-counter discomfort medication. It's normal to feel some degree of pain after the surgery, however taking medicine like advil or acetaminophen can aid. Make certain to adhere to the instructions for dose and seek advice from your dental professional or pharmacist if you have any type of concerns.

Additionally, applying alpha dental lab to the affected location for 15 mins at once can help reduce swelling and provide short-lived relief. It is necessary to rest and avoid difficult tasks for the first couple of days to allow your body to recover.


Throughout this duration, ensure to look after on your own and offer concern to your recovery process.

Methods for keeping dental health and performing dental cleansing.



To guarantee a smooth and successful healing, it is very important to prioritize good oral health methods and routinely clean your oral implant.

To ensure the long-term wellness and success of your oral implant, it's vital to maintain great dental health behaviors. This consists of brushing your teeth at the very least twice a day with a soft-bristled tooth brush and non-abrasive toothpaste. When cleaning, make sure to be gentle around the implant location to prevent any type of damage.

In addition, flossing is essential to remove plaque and food particles that can build up around the dental implant. Utilize a floss threader or interdental brush to clean between the dental implant and adjacent teeth.

In addition, making use of an antimicrobial dental rinse can aid in decreasing bacteria and supporting dental health.

Normal dental check-ups and specialist cleansings are also necessary to keep an eye on the condition of your oral implant and resolve any type of potential concerns.

Dietary Considerations and Restrictions



After obtaining a dental implant, it is vital to beware and familiar with certain aspects and constraints regarding your diet regimen. Although you may be passionate regarding resuming your regular consuming patterns, it is important to allow adequate time for your dental implant to recover efficiently.

In the very first couple of days after surgical treatment, you must stick to a soft or fluid diet to stay clear of putting excessive pressure on the implant site. alpha dental services inc implies avoiding hard, crunchy, or sticky foods that can potentially remove or damage the implant. It's additionally recommended to prevent hot foods and drinks, as they can increase pain and swelling.

As your implant heals, you can slowly reintroduce solid foods, however beware and eat on the contrary side of your mouth to avoid any unneeded stress on the dental implant. Remember to comply with any type of particular dietary guidelines given by your dentist and speak with them if you have any kind of concerns.
